A short introduction to the ideas behind the book

Recipes for Resilience is a reflection-based exploration of how resilience is built — not through formulas or prescriptions, but through real human experience.

The book brings together conversations with people from different backgrounds and professions — leaders, parents, athletes, physicians, educators — all navigating pressure, uncertainty, loss, and change in their own ways.What emerges is not a single definition of resilience, but a shared language.

Across twelve themes — including connection, self-awareness, pause, trust, and adaptation — the book invites readers to slow down, reflect, and recognize the skills they are already developing, often without realizing it. This is not a step-by-step program.

It is not sport-specific.

It is not prescriptive advice.

It is a collection of stories and reflections designed to help readers notice patterns, reframe experiences, and build steadiness over time.
